Listed by Saunders Property Group - LauncestonSet at the end of a quiet country lane, this exceptional 12.33-hectare property offers the ideal blend of productivity, lifestyle, and future opportunity. A true agricultural dream, the farm features a thriving, established olive grove renowned for producing award-winning olive oil, while the balance of the land currently supports merino wethers and generates additional income through hay production. Serviced by town water and supported by a substantial dam, the property enjoys excellent water security, ensuring long-term viability for a variety of agricultural pursuits.
At the heart of this impressive holding is a beautifully renovated four-bedroom, two-bathroom family home. Warm, inviting Tasmanian oak flooring flows throughout, complementing the home's contemporary comfort and country charm. Dual living areas offer flexibility for families, while the expansive pool deck and outdoor entertaining zone create the perfect setting for summer gatherings, long lunches, or simply unwinding in complete privacy.
For buyers with an eye on the future, the property presents exciting potential for subdivision (STCA), with Hadspen experiencing rapid growth and development over recent years. Whether you're seeking a productive farm, a peaceful rural lifestyle, or an astute long-term investment, this property delivers on every level.
Perfectly positioned just 15 minutes from the Launceston CBD and benefiting from excellent access, 121 Saunders Drive offers an unmatched opportunity to secure a premium acreage property in one of the region's most sought-after growth corridors.
